Outrageous Fishing – Reel-a-Lure
With Outrageous Fishing, you will be able to battle some of the most exciting fish species around. All you have to do is head down to Houtbay and Millers Point to run deep and make a great catch possible.
Your boat for the day will be the ‘Reel-a-Lure,’ a beautiful 23’ Ace Craft that was recently restored and comes powered by twin 140 HP Suzuki engines. With enough room for up to 4 anglers and professional accessories and top-notch gear, the Reel-a-Lure is ideal for a productive day on the water. She features a full set of electronics, a restroom, an ice-box for the catch, and outriggers.
The Reel-a-Lure is operated by Skipper Byron, who will take you out for Marlin, Sharks, and Tuna, as well as many other species. You will be able to try your hand at fly fishing for Snoek and Yellowtail, spend your day fishing the reefs for Red Roman, Cape Salmon, and Cob, or enjoy the world-class Tuna spearfishing.
The finest reels by Shimano, along with rods, tackle, bait, and lures, will be provided for your trip. You will need to bring all the necessary fly fishing and spearfishing equipment if needed. Once you’re done fishing, the first mate will clean your catch for you. Please note that tips are highly appreciated!
Your lunch and drinks are also welcome on board the Reel-a-Lure.
